OKLAHOMA CITY -- UPDATE: The Moore Police Department has canceled a Silver Alert for a missing man.
William Wilson, 62, was found Wednesday morning near N.W. 10th Street and Hudson in Oklahoma City.
MOORE, Oklahoma -- A Silver Alert has been issued for a 62-year-old man who went missing Tuesday evening.
Staff at Hillcrest Nursing Home reported they last saw William Elliott Wilson around 5 p.m. He was reported missing at 11 p.m. Wilson has Alzheimer's disease and schizophrenia.
Wilson is described as 5 feet 2 inches tall and approximately 130 pounds. He has graying brown hair and brown eyes. He also has a cross tattoo on his forehead, and tattoo on his left forearm.
